Power Grid's Q1 profit falls on one-time rebate to discoms

New Delhi, Power Grid Corporation has reported an 18.15 per cent fall in its consolidated net profit for the April-June quarter at Rs 2,048.42 crore.

During the corresponding period last fiscal, the company had reported a net profit of Rs 2,502.80 crore.

US stocks fall as tech shares slide

New York, US stocks dropped, dragged by losses in big tech names.

Markets open in red

Mumbai, The 30-scrip Sensitive Index (Sensex) on Wednesday opened on a negative note during the morning session of the trade.

The Sensex of the BSE opened at 38,321.13 points which was also the high point. The Sensex touched a low of 38,125.81 points.

Tesla stock up 7% after car maker announces 5-1 share split

San Francisco, Elon Musk-run Tesla has announced a five-for-one split of its common stock that goes into effect on August 21.

The move that could help smaller investors afford Tesla stock resulted in Tesla stock surging 7 per cent in the extended session on Tuesday.

COVID-19 hits 18 footballers of Brazilian Serie B side CSA

Rio de Janeiro, A Brazilian second division football match has been postponed after 18 players from Central Sportivo Alagoano (CSA) tested positive for the novel coronavirus.
